Signal strength management
First Claim
1. A method for signal strength management, the method comprising:
- receiving information from a first electronic communication device, wherein the received information includes one or more settings that identify at least one action to be performed after a forecast that signal strength received by the first electronic communication device will likely be reduced in the future;
receiving a measure of signal strength from the first electronic communication device, wherein the measure of signal strength includes a current measured signal strength measured by the first electronic communication device;
sharing the measure of signal strength with a plurality of other devices allowed to receive signal strength information from the first electronic communication device, wherein the first electronic device receives one or more measures of signal strength from the other devices;
identifying a current location of the first electronic communication device;
identifying a velocity of the first electronic communication device, wherein the identified velocity is greater than zero;
identifying a path of travel along which the first electronic communication device is traveling;
accessing a database, wherein the database associates a signal strength with a plurality of different locations, and wherein the database is updated with signal strength data from a plurality of electronic communication devices located in the different locations;
forecasting that the signal strength received by the first electronic communication device will likely be reduced in the future, wherein the reduced signal strength is forecasted based on the current location, the velocity, the path of travel, and the database associating signal strength with locations; and
performing the at least one action after the forecast that the signal strength of the first electronic communication device will likely be reduced in the future according to the one or more settings received from the first electronic communication device, wherein the at least one action includes sending an alert to the third party indicating that the signal strength received by the first electronic device will likely reduce in the future, the alert specifying one or more recommendations for responding to the forecast of likely reduction in signal strength.

Abstract
Methods and systems for signal strength management are provided. A first (mobile) communication device may provide a server with information relating to the signal strength, and such information may be used to determine future signal strength (e.g., at a different location). The first user may see the signal strength of a second communication device with which it may be communicating. The communication device may also communicate with a system that maintains a real-time database of signal strengths throughout an area, such as a state. A user'"'"'s handheld device may receive a indications, warnings, and recommended courses of action that the user may take to maintain communications when a signal strength of a wireless communication network is predicted to change. Users of the present invention may take actions to insure that the quality of their call is maintained.
